Tips to Create a Waste Management Plan for Outdoor Events

Hosting an outdoor event can be extremely rewarding. From music festivals and sporting events to weddings and family reunions, these occasions are often the highlights of the year. However, they also generate a lot of waste that can have a negative impact on the environment if not properly managed. This is where a waste management plan comes in handy. In this blog post, we will provide you with tips on how to create a waste management plan for outdoor events that will help minimize your environmental impact while keeping your event clean and safe.

 

1. Understand the Waste Stream

The first step in creating a waste management plan for outdoor events is to understand the waste stream. This means assessing the types of waste generated, their quantities, and the frequency of their occurrence. Common types of waste generated at outdoor events include food waste, plastic bottles and cups, cigarette butts, and paper products. By understanding the waste stream, you can plan for appropriate collection and disposal methods.

2. Provide Sufficient Waste Collection Points

Providing sufficient waste collection points is essential to keep your event site clean and safe. This means strategically placing waste containers throughout the event site in high traffic areas. You should also ensure that waste containers of different types (e.g. for recyclables and food waste) are provided and clearly marked to facilitate proper sorting.

3. Encourage Recycling and Composting

Encouraging recycling and composting is one of the most effective ways to minimize waste at your outdoor event. This can be achieved by providing recycling and composting bins, educating attendees on what items are recyclable or compostable, and incentivizing proper waste disposal. For instance, you can offer prizes to attendees who properly sort their waste.

4. Partner With Waste Management Companies

Partnering with waste management companies can help ensure that your event waste is properly handled and disposed of. These companies can provide roll off containers, dumpsters, or portable toilets, depending on your needs. It's important to choose reputable waste management companies that have experience handling waste at outdoor events and are committed to sustainability.

5. Have a Post-Event Cleanup Plan

Having a post-event cleanup plan is essential for ensuring that the event site is left clean and free of litter. This involves allocating resources for cleaning up the site, including removing waste containers, sorting and disposing of waste, and collecting and sorting recyclable materials. A well-executed post-event cleanup plan can help ensure that your event is remembered for its success and not its impact on the environment.
